What is the importance of language for a policy?

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 02-07-2020

Answer:

It is  important to develop language policiesbecause it ensures the access of minority populations to prestigious forms of national standard languages and literacies. while supporting the intergenerational retention of minority languages, both indigenous and immigrant languages
